## Account Recovery — Trailnote Offline Mode

When a surveyor's Trailnote app has been offline for 30+ days, their local credentials expire and sync refuses to resume. Don't make them wipe the device — all their unsynced field data lives there! Instead, open the support console, pick "Offline Reinstate," and enter their handle. The console will ask for the support team's shared recovery passphrase before issuing a reinstatement token. Use the one below.

unlock words, bagaf-fajeg: zorael-kelax-fraath-quenix-eliok-sileth-aldmir-wenir-druiel

Contractor access, week one — Hatch & Dunmore site, Keelson Wharf. Sign in at the lobby each morning; no tailgating through the turnstiles. Your sponsor must collect you on day one. Days two to five, use the contractor lane at the north entrance. Hard hats are issued at the site office, not reception. Do not prop fire doors. The contractor lane keypad takes the code below.

door code, yagap-bahof: bdg-O-05

Ticket FAC-2291 — Quiet Room, Level 7, Bexford Tower. Door handle sticks; contractor from Mortlake Joinery attending Thursday morning. Reception: sign the contractor in, issue a visitor lanyard, and walk them up — no unescorted access to Level 7. Room stays bookable meanwhile; warn users of noise. Contractor must sign out by 12:00. The keypad will be disabled during the repair, so escort staff in as needed using the override code below.

door code, kahap-kawip: bdg-XUDDCY-22034334

Welcome aboard! You'll mostly be working on Quellbot, our on-call alert deduplicator. It collapses duplicate pages within a five-minute window and routes the survivor to the right rotation. Staging access is open; prod needs Hana's sign-off. To pull the staging credentials bundle, unlock the secrets vault with the passphrase below.

vault phrase of yagag-yafof = belael-weniel-kasion-silath-jorax-pelox-silir-soreth-ralmir